All Downloads are FREE. Search and download functionalities are using the official Maven repository.

templates.includes.webclient.ksoap.include.vm Maven / Gradle / Ivy

There is a newer version: 3.5.0
Show newest version
#set ( $webServiceInfo         = $sourceinfo.webServiceInfo )
#set ( $axisService            = $webServiceInfo.axisService)
#set ( $typeTable              = $webServiceInfo.typeTable)   
#set ( $CLASS_PREFIX					 ="K"                         )
#set ( $I_CONSTANT						 ="Constants"                 )
#set ( $C_UTILITS  						 ="Utilits"                   )
#set ( $I_NS						       ="Namespace"                 )
#set ( $C_ENVELOPE						 ="XEnvelope"                 )
#set ( $C_GZIPHTTPTRANSPORT	 	 ="HttpTransportSEWithGzip"   )
#set ( $V_COMPLEXTYPES         ="COMPLEX_TYPES"             )
#set ( $SUFFIX_STUB            ="Stub"                      )
#set ( $SUFFIX_FACTORY         ="Factory"                   )
#set ( $stubClassName          ="${sourceinfo.serviceClass.simpleName}$SUFFIX_STUB")
## inline: $parentSchema,$inline
#macro(getKname $type)
#set( $qn=$typeTable.getComplexSchemaType($type.name))
#if($qn)
$webServiceInfo.getPrefix($qn).toUpperCase()$type.simpleName#else#typeName($type)
#end
#end




© 2015 - 2025 Weber Informatics LLC | Privacy Policy